Intel Xeon D-2146NT vs Intel Xeon D-2733NT
The Intel Xeon D-2146NT operates with 8 cores and 16 CPU threads. It run at 3.00 GHz base 2.30 GHz all cores while the TDP is set at 80 W.The processor is attached to the BGA 2518 CPU socket. This version includes -- of L3 cache on one chip, supports 4 memory channels to support DDR4-2133 RAM and features PCIe Gen lanes. Tjunction keeps below -- degrees C. In particular, Skylake Architecture is enhanced with 14 nm technology and supports VT-x, VT-x EPT, VT-d. The product was launched on Q1/2018
The Intel Xeon D-2733NT operates with 8 cores and 16 CPU threads. It run at 3.20 GHz base 2.70 GHz all cores while the TDP is set at 80 W.The processor is attached to the BGA 2579 CPU socket. This version includes -- of L3 cache on one chip, supports 4 memory channels to support DDR4-2666 RAM and features PCIe Gen lanes. Tjunction keeps below -- degrees C. In particular, Ice Lake Architecture is enhanced with 10 nm technology and supports VT-x, VT-x EPT, VT-d. The product was launched on Q1/2022
